There's a ton of research into implicit, demographic and cognitive biases in traditional job interviews, so much so that most HRM professionals at top companies have started conducting what is called Structured Interviews which are built to specifically remove potential for bias interference in the interview process. The traditional interview process, which is what I'm assuming you're saying you're good at, has been researched and shown to be a biased and wildly inconsistent way to hire the best…
